Job Title
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Adhere to all Graymont safety standards, principles, policies, and procedures.
- Complete all required training as specified by MSHA and Graymont standards.
- Load rail cars and assist loading trucks as directed.
- All product handling responsibilities.
- Operate production equipment, including but not limited to the lime handling, crushing and screening processes and lime operations.
- Verify proper lubrication and fluid levels and perform standard lubrication tasks.
- Assist in preventative maintenance and other minor maintenance tasks on mobile and stationary plant equipment, including but not limited to front end loader, forklift, skid steer, street sweeper.
- Perform housekeeping duties, including but not limited to shoveling, sweeping, operating the street sweeper, etc.
- Other duties as assigned.
QUALIFICATIONS
- Must be at least 18 years of age.
- Strong safety values and commitment to working safely
- Strong mechanical aptitude.
- Ability to use a computer and to understand and use computer software.
- Ability to use various hand and electrical tools.
- Must be able to climb ladders, stairways, be capable of working at heights and in areas with fluctuating temperatures.
- Ability to effectively communicate in a professional manner in person, through email and using radios or phones
- Ability to work independently and in a team setting.
- Ability to work 8 to 12 hours.
- Ability to work any day, including weekends, holidays and any shift including overnight shifts.
- Must be able to work overtime as needed, including extra hours on short notice.
